Prayer : Petition filed under Section 11 of the Contempt of Courts Act, 1971 to punish the respondents for their act of contempt of court for deliberately disobeying the order dated 06.03.2020 in W.P.No.34741 of 2019. For the Petitioner : Mr.K.Balaji For the Respondents : Mr.P.Muthukumar State Government Pleader assisted by Mr.K.M.D.Mugilan Government Advocate

ORDER

(Order of the Court was made by the Hon'ble Chief Justice) A compliance report has been submitted by learned counsel appearing for the contemnors. It is stated that a final report after completion of the investigation has been submitted and, in view of the above, the order dated 06.03.2020 passed in W.P.No.34741 of 2019 has been complied with.

2. With regard to the direction to conduct periodical inspection, it is submitted that the respondents would conduct periodical inspection and take necessary action against anyone indulging in illegal mining.

3. In view of the aforesaid, nothing survives in the contempt petition and, accordingly, it is ordered to be closed with discharge of the notice to the contemnors. However, it would not preclude the petitioner from filing a

fresh writ petition, if illegal mining is again carried on in the future. There will be no order as to costs.
